Comprehensive Guide to Improving Gut Health Naturally for Young Adults in Luxembourg

Gut health is a crucial aspect of overall wellness, especially for young adults striving to maintain energy, immunity, and mental clarity. This guide provides actionable, science-backed strategies tailored for adults aged 23-30 in Luxembourg who want to optimize their digestive health naturally.

Understanding the Importance of Gut Health

The gut microbiome comprises trillions of bacteria and other microorganisms that influence digestion, immunity, mood, and even skin health. An imbalanced gut can lead to issues such as bloating, fatigue, and weakened immunity.

Key Factors Affecting Gut Health in Young Adults

  • Dietary choices
  • Stress levels
  • Sleep quality
  • Physical activity
  • Use of antibiotics and medications

Effective Natural Strategies to Boost Gut Health

1. Incorporate Fermented Foods

Fermented foods are rich in probiotics that replenish healthy gut bacteria. Examples suitable for young adults in Luxembourg:

  • Sauerkraut
  • Kombucha
  • Kimchi
  • Yogurt with live cultures

Adding these foods daily supports microbial diversity and digestion.

2. Increase Dietary Fiber Intake

Dietary fiber acts as fuel for beneficial bacteria and promotes regular bowel movements. Focus on:

  • Whole grains (e.g., oats, rye)
  • Vegetables (e.g., carrots, broccoli)
  • Fruits (e.g., apples, berries)
  • Legumes

While fiber is essential, increase intake gradually to prevent bloating.

3. Prioritize Hydration and Limit Sugary Drinks

Staying well-hydrated ensures smooth digestion and supports microbial balance. Aim for at least 1.5–2 liters of water daily. Reduce consumption of sugary beverages that can disturb gut flora.

4. Manage Stress Effectively

Chronic stress negatively impacts gut health by altering gut microbiota and increasing intestinal permeability. Incorporate stress-reduction techniques such as:

  • Meditation
  • Deep breathing exercises
  • Yoga
  • Mindfulness practices

Regular physical activity also aids in stress reduction and gut motility.

5. Optimize Sleep Patterns

Quality sleep is essential for gut recovery and microbiome balance. Establish a consistent sleep schedule, avoid screens before bedtime, and create a calm sleeping environment.

6. Limit Use of Antibiotics and Unnecessary Medications

While antibiotics are sometimes necessary, overuse can severely impact gut bacteria. Consult with healthcare professionals and consider probiotics during and after antibiotic treatments.

Supplementation and Probiotics

If diet alone isn’t enough, probiotic supplements can help restore microbial balance. Look for strains like Lactobacillus and Bifidobacterium. Always choose high-quality, reputable brands and consult a healthcare provider.

Additional Tips for Gut Wellness

  • Reduce processed foods and refined sugars
  • Eat mindfully and chew thoroughly
  • Limit alcohol intake
  • Maintain regular physical activity (e.g., walking, cycling)

FAQs: Your Gut Health Questions Answered

Q1: How long does it take to see improvements in gut health?

Typically, noticeable changes can occur within 2–4 weeks of consistent dietary and lifestyle modifications, but full gut microbiome adjustment may take up to several months.

Q2: Are natural remedies safe for everyone?

Most natural strategies are safe, but individuals with underlying health conditions should consult a healthcare provider before starting new supplements or major dietary changes.

Q3: Can stress really impact my gut?

Yes, chronic stress can disrupt gut microbiota, impair digestion, and increase inflammation. Managing stress is a key component of gut health.

Q4: Should I avoid dairy if I want better gut health?

Not necessarily. Some tolerate fermented dairy well, while others might benefit from reducing non-fermented dairy if they experience bloating or discomfort.

Q5: What are signs of poor gut health?

Common indicators include bloating, gas, irregular bowel movements, fatigue, and frequent infections or colds.
